Best Time to Visit Galashiels, United Kingdom
Galashiels experiences a temperate maritime climate, characterized by mild summers and cool winters. The best time to visit Galashiels is during the summer months, from June to August, when the weather is pleasant and the days are longer. During this time, you can enjoy outdoor activities and explore the natural beauty of the surrounding countryside.
In terms of temperature, Galashiels sees an average high of 19°C (66°F) in July and August, while the average low temperature in winter, particularly in December and January, hovers around 2°C (36°F). It is worth noting that rainfall is fairly evenly distributed throughout the year, so it is advisable to pack a waterproof jacket regardless of the season.

Top Sights of Galashiels, United Kingdom
Galashiels boasts several captivating sights that showcase its rich history and natural beauty. Here are five top places to visit during your vacation:
1. Scott's View
Scott's View, a scenic viewpoint located near Galashiels, offers breathtaking panoramic views of the rolling hills and the meandering River Tweed. This spot was a favorite of Sir Walter Scott, who found inspiration in its beauty.
2. Melrose Abbey
Just a short drive from Galashiels, Melrose Abbey is a magnificent ruin that dates back to the 12th century. Explore the intricate architecture, wander through the peaceful grounds, and learn about the abbey's fascinating history.
3. Gala Policies Nature Reserve
Gala Policies Nature Reserve is a tranquil haven for nature lovers. Take a leisurely walk along the nature trails, spot a variety of bird species, and immerse yourself in the serene beauty of the surrounding woodlands.

FAQ
What is the history of Galashiels?
Galashiels was established in the 14th century and has a rich history that revolves around the textile industry. It played a significant role in the production of woollen textiles, particularly during the Industrial Revolution.
How can I get to Galashiels?
Galashiels is well-connected by road and rail. The nearest airport is Edinburgh Airport, which is approximately 40 miles away. From there, you can take a train or hire a car to reach Galashiels.

Are there any local festivals or events in Galashiels?
Yes, Galashiels hosts various festivals and events throughout the year. The Galashiels Braw Lads Gathering, held in June, is a traditional celebration that showcases the town's history and culture. Additionally, the Borders Book Festival, held in nearby Melrose, attracts renowned authors and literary enthusiasts from around the world.
